/*==========*/ /* The Grid */ /*==========*/ .grid { display: grid; grid-gap: 1rem; --minimum: 20ch; } @supports (width: min(var(--minumum), 100%)) { .grid { grid-template-columns: repeat(auto-fit, minmax(min(var(--minimum), 100%), 1fr)); } }